Megosztás a következőn keresztül:


Start-OBRecovery

Az OBRecoverableItem objektumok tömbjének helyreállítása az OBRecoverableOptions objektumban megadott helyreállítási lehetőségekkel.

Syntax

Start-OBRecovery
     [-RecoverableItem] <CBRecoverableItem[]>
     [[-RecoveryOption] <CBRecoveryOption>]
     [[-EncryptionPassphrase] <SecureString>]
     [-Async]
     [-Confirm]
     [-WhatIf]

Description

A Start-OBRecovery parancsmag helyreállítja az OBRecoverableItem objektumok tömböt az OBRecoverableOptions objektumban megadott helyreállítási lehetőségekkel. Alternatív kiszolgáló-helyreállítás esetén a helyreállításhoz a hitelesítőadat- és titkosítási jelszóobjektumra lenne szükség.

Ha nincs megadva helyreállítási lehetőség, a rendszer a következő alapértelmezett beállításokat használja.

  1. Visszaállítás eredeti helyre.
  2. Másolatok létrehozása ütközés esetén.
  3. A fájlok ACL-jeinek visszaállítása.

Amikor egy másik kiszolgáló visszaállítási folyamatához állít vissza adatokat, a parancsmag hibaüzenetet jelenít meg, ha az OBRecoverableOptions objektum nincs megadva, mert nincs alapértelmezett eredeti hely egy másik kiszolgálóról történő helyreállításban.

Ez a parancsmag közepes hatással támogatja a WhatIf és a Confirm paramétereket. A közepes hatás azt jelzi, hogy a parancsmag alapértelmezés szerint nem kéri a felhasználótól a megerősítést. A WhatIf paraméter részletes leírást ad arról, hogy mit végez a parancsmag művelet nélkül. A Megerősítés paraméter azt határozza meg, hogy a parancsmagnak fel kell-e kérnie a felhasználót. A -Confirm:$FALSE használatával felülbírálhatja a kérést.

A Microsoft Azure Backup parancsmagok használatához a felhasználónak rendszergazdának kell lennie a védett gépen.

Példák

1. PÉLDA

$sources = Get-OBRecoverableSource



$RP = Get-OBRecoverableItem -Source $sources[0]



$passphrase = Read-Host -Prompt "Enter encryption passphrase" -AsSecureString



$pwd = ConvertTo-SecureString -String Notag00dpa55word -AsPlainText -Force



$cred = New-Object -TypeName System.Management.Automation.PsCredential -ArgumentList contoso\johnj99, $pwd



$RO = New-OBRecoveryOption -DestinationPath C:\\test -OverwriteType Overwrite



Start-OBRecovery -RecoverableItem $RP -RecoveryOption $RO -EncryptionPassphrase $passphrase -Credential $cred -Async

Ez a példa elindít egy helyreállítási feladatot.

Paraméterek

-Async

Lehetővé teszi a felhasználó számára, hogy jelezze, hogy a parancsmagnak aszinkron módon kell futnia. Ez olyan parancsmagok esetén hasznos, amelyek végrehajtása hosszú időt vesz igénybe. A vezérlő közvetlenül a művelet után visszatér a felhasználóhoz.

Típus:SwitchParameter
Position:5
Alapértelmezett érték:None
Kötelező:False
Folyamatbemenet elfogadása:False
Helyettesítő karakterek elfogadása:False

-Confirm

Jóváhagyást kér a parancsmag futtatása előtt.

Típus:SwitchParameter
Position:Named
Alapértelmezett érték:False
Kötelező:False
Folyamatbemenet elfogadása:False
Helyettesítő karakterek elfogadása:False

-EncryptionPassphrase

Megadja a helyreállítási adatok visszafejtéséhez használandó titkosítási jelszót. Ennek meg kell egyeznie a biztonsági mentéshez beállított legújabb titkosítási jelszóval. Erre alternatív kiszolgáló-helyreállítás esetén van szükség. Alternatív kiszolgáló helyreállítása esetén ennek a titkosítási jelszónak meg kell egyeznie az eredeti kiszolgálón biztonsági mentésre beállított legújabb titkosítási jelszóval.

Típus:SecureString
Position:4
Alapértelmezett érték:None
Kötelező:False
Folyamatbemenet elfogadása:True
Helyettesítő karakterek elfogadása:False

-RecoverableItem

Meghatározza a helyreállítandó elemeket.

Típus:CBRecoverableItem[]
Position:2
Alapértelmezett érték:None
Kötelező:True
Folyamatbemenet elfogadása:True
Helyettesítő karakterek elfogadása:False

-RecoveryOption

Azt határozza meg, hogy a helyreállított elemek felülírják-e a meglévő példányokat, vagy hogy létre kell-e hozni a meglévő elemek másolatait a helyreállítás során.

Típus:CBRecoveryOption
Position:3
Alapértelmezett érték:None
Kötelező:False
Folyamatbemenet elfogadása:True
Helyettesítő karakterek elfogadása:False

-WhatIf

Bemutatja, mi történne a parancsmag futtatásakor. A parancsmag nem fut.

Típus:SwitchParameter
Position:Named
Alapértelmezett érték:False
Kötelező:False
Folyamatbemenet elfogadása:False
Helyettesítő karakterek elfogadása:False

Bevitelek

None

Kimenetek

Microsoft.Internal.CloudBackup.Client.Cmdlets.OBJob